Comprehending the TCF Test
Before diving into the booking procedure, it is important to comprehend what the TCF test requires. The TCF examines 4 primary skills:
Listening Comprehension: The capability to comprehend spoken French through different audio materials.Checking out Comprehension: The ability to read and understand written French texts.Written Expression: The capability to write coherently in French.Oral Expression: The skill to interact successfully in spoken French.
The test is divided into obligatory elements and optional sections, permitting prospects to tailor their assessment based upon their requirements.

How much does it cost to book the TCF test?
The expense differs by checking center and nation, typically ranging from ₤ 100 to ₤ 250.
The length of time does it take to get outcomes?
Results are generally available within 2 to four weeks after taking the test, depending upon the center.
Can I reschedule my test?
Many centers allow rescheduling, but it typically sustains an extra cost. Make certain to examine the policy on rescheduling when booking.
Exists a credibility period for TCF Test Online Purchase results?
TCF outcomes are typically legitimate for 2 years, though some institutions might have different requirements.
Exist lodgings for people with impairments?
Yes, most testing centers provide accommodations. Candidates need to call the center directly to discuss their requirements.
